Client Relationship Representative I U.S.
Description
The Client Relationship Representative delivers on the promise Purolator International makes to our customers and our customers make to their customers. This position is the account management primary point of contact for customers for all items related to the pickup, customs clearance, delivery, billing, track/trace, Accounts Receivable, IT, reporting and operations components for the freight customers give to Purolator International. The primary role and accountability is to be receptive and accessible to your designated group of customers, as well as to cover for other Customer Specialists within and across the district when needed. This role also addresses customers who may call into the line for service.
Responsibilities
- Develop key external relationships with each assigned customer - serve as the day-to-day point of contact/face of Purolator International using both verbal and written communication
- Recognize, identify, anticipate, develop, and manage processes and issues which impact or affect internal and external customers
- Generate customer facing service reports by exporting information from internal system and manipulating data to show metrics and trends
- Track and manage weekly service exceptions, end delivery report/auditing reports to ensure accurate internal and external measures of Purolator International’s on time performance
- Complete internal and external reports within set deadline
- Maintain onboarding process and stabilization of new customers
- Monthly proactive calls to each customer confirming customer satisfaction—defining future needs, how we can improve/better solution their operation
- Answering calls that come into the queue and assisting the caller from start to finish
- Other duties as assigned
Experience
- 2+ years progressive experience in a Client Account Management role, where managing external customers, problem solving and troubleshooting issues is a part of the daily job function
- Proficiency in Microsoft Excel
- Successful track record of building internal and external customer relationships
- Maintaining daily workload with little supervision; exceptional organizational skills and ability to pivot
